In some cases "label" DT property can be used also as interface name. For example this property is already used by DSA kernel driver. I created very simple script which renames all interfaces in system to their "label" DT property (if there is any defined). #!/bin/sh for iface in `ls /sys/class/net/`; do for of_node in of_node device/of_node; do if test -e /sys/class/net/$iface/$of_node/; then label=`cat /sys/class/net/$iface/$of_node/label 2>/dev/null` if test -n "$label" && test "$label" != "$iface"; then echo "Renaming net interface $iface to $label..." up=$((`cat /sys/class/net/$iface/flags 2>/dev/null || echo 1` & 0x1)) if test "$up" != "0"; then ip link set dev $iface down fi ip link set dev $iface name "$label" && iface=$label if test "$up" != "0"; then ip link set dev $iface up fi fi break fi done done Maybe it would be better first to use "label" and then use ethernet alias?
